BBC Top Gear is the UK’s best-selling car magazine and delivers innovative and exciting motoring news and views from across the globe every month. With the best writers Top Gear puts you behind the wheel of the greatest cars money can buy, and with the best automotive photographers, Top Gear is a visual treat every month. Plus of course, Top Gear is the only magazine in the world where you can read the combined talents of our very own Jeremy Clarkson, James May and Richard Hammond every month. In First Drives we give every car that matters a thorough toad test the Top Gear way and in The News Top Gear tells you what’s new and exciting in the car world each month. Planet Top Gear is where we bring you stories from the weird world of cars and the Options List is our monthly run down of cool stuff every motoring fan needs. All this plus a comprehensive 60 page buyers guide and the Top Gear Garage means that Top Gear is the magazine to cater for all your motoring needs.

The Pocketmags app runs on all iPad and iPhone devices running iOS 13.0 or above, Android 5.0 or above and Fire Tablet (Gen 3) or above. Our web-reader works with any HTML5 compatible browser, for PC and Mac we recommend Chrome or Firefox.
For iOS we recommend any device which can run the latest iOS for better performance and stability. Earlier models with lower processor and RAM specifications may experience slower page rendering and occasional app crashes which are outside of our control.
